Postchemistry of organic particles : when TTF microparticles meet TCNQ microstructures in aqueous solution.

Abstract:
|
Through the use of preformed tetrathiafulvalene (TTF) particles and 7,7′,8,8′-tetracyanoquinodimethane (TCNQ) microstructures as starting materials, the postchemistry of organic particles has been demonstrated for the first time in aqueous solution. The as-synthesized TTF−TCNQ nanowires show stable performance in organic nonvolatile memory devices with multiple write−read−erase−read cycles in air. |
